Askonas Holt’s Toursand Projects Department is active around the world; however it is a special pleasure to bring a series of outstanding projects to London during the course of the 2014-15 season.
The Berliner Philharmoniker celebrates Sir Simon Rattle’s 60th birthday in style with a Sibelius Symphony Cycle at the Barbican Hall as well as Mahler and Helmut Lachenmann at the Royal Festival Hall. Also joining the programme at the Southbank Centre are the Simón Bolívar Symphony Orchestra under Gustavo Dudamel; the Philadelphia Orchestra with Yannick Nézet-Séguin; and the ever-remarkable Daniel Barenboim, who performs a Schubert Piano Sonata Cycle as well as leading his own Staatskapelle Berlin in Beethoven, Strauss and Elgar. And in a season of illustrious visitors, the New York Philharmonic also continues its Barbican residency with a diverse and intriguing offering of orchestral, theatrical and educational performances.
